| OLD | NEW |
| 1 /* copied from kernel definition, but with padding replaced | 1 /* copied from kernel definition, but with padding replaced |
| 2 * by the corresponding correctly-sized userspace types. */ | 2 * by the corresponding correctly-sized userspace types. */ |
| 3 | 3 |
| 4 struct stat { | 4 struct stat { |
| 5 » dev_t st_dev; | 5 dev_t st_dev; |
| 6 » ino_t st_ino; | 6 ino_t st_ino; |
| 7 » nlink_t st_nlink; | 7 nlink_t st_nlink; |
| 8 | 8 |
| 9 » mode_t st_mode; | 9 mode_t st_mode; |
| 10 » uid_t st_uid; | 10 uid_t st_uid; |
| 11 » gid_t st_gid; | 11 gid_t st_gid; |
| 12 » unsigned int __pad0; | 12 unsigned int __pad0; |
| 13 » dev_t st_rdev; | 13 dev_t st_rdev; |
| 14 » off_t st_size; | 14 off_t st_size; |
| 15 » blksize_t st_blksize; | 15 blksize_t st_blksize; |
| 16 » blkcnt_t st_blocks; | 16 blkcnt_t st_blocks; |
| 17 | 17 |
| 18 » struct timespec st_atim; | 18 struct timespec st_atim; |
| 19 » struct timespec st_mtim; | 19 struct timespec st_mtim; |
| 20 » struct timespec st_ctim; | 20 struct timespec st_ctim; |
| 21 » long __unused[3]; | 21 long __unused[3]; |
| 22 }; | 22 }; |
| OLD | NEW |